Embedded Finance: Leveraging BaaS for Growth

The financial landscape is rapidly evolving, with consumer demand driving a surge in innovation. Embedded finance, the integration of financial services directly into non-financial platforms and applications, is at the forefront of this transformation. By leveraging Banking as a Service (BaaS), businesses can seamlessly integrate financial functionality into their existing ecosystems, providing users with frictionless access to essential financial tools and services.

This strategic utilization of BaaS empowers businesses to target new customer segments, enhance user engagement, and drive revenue growth. By offering tailored financial solutions within their own platforms, companies can foster stronger customer relationships and gain a competitive edge.

  • Advantages of leveraging BaaS for embedded finance include:
  • Accelerated development cycles: BaaS platforms provide pre-built infrastructure and modules, enabling businesses to integrate financial services quickly and efficiently.
  • Reduced operational costs: Outsourcing core banking functionalities to specialized providers allows companies to focus on their primary business objectives and reduce overhead expenses.
  • Data protection measures: Reputable BaaS providers adhere to strict industry compliance frameworks, ensuring the security and privacy of customer financial data.

Building Seamless Fintech Experiences with BaaS

The financial technology landscape is rapidly evolving, with a surge in demand for advanced financial solutions. To cater to this growing need, businesses are increasingly turning to Banking as a Service (BaaS) platforms. BaaS offers a powerful suite of tools and services that enable companies to develop seamless fintech experiences into their own applications.

By leveraging BaaS, businesses can accelerate the development process and concentrate on creating a outstanding user experience.

BaaS platforms provide a range of essential banking functionalities, such as account management, payments processing, risk management, and regulatory compliance services. This allows businesses to build sophisticated fintech applications without the need for significant infrastructure.

The advantages of using BaaS are manifold. Some key benefits include:

* Reduced development time and costs

* Increased agility and flexibility

* Access to a wider range of financial services

* Enhanced security and compliance

* Improved customer experience

By embracing BaaS, businesses can unlock the opportunities of fintech and create disruptive solutions that change the industry.

Democratizing Finance Through Banking as a Service

Banking as a Service (BaaS) is revolutionizing the financial landscape by making banking services attainable to a wider range of individuals and businesses. This paradigm shift allows non-traditional players, such as fintech startups and technology companies, to utilize banking infrastructure, offering innovative financial products and services. BaaS empowers businesses to build financial functionalities into their platforms, creating seamless experiences for users. By lowering barriers to entry, BaaS promotes competition and fuels financial inclusion. This equitable distribution of financial services has the potential to transform individuals and communities by providing them with tools to manage their finances, access credit, and build a secure financial future.
